Civil Service Shake-Up: Tinubu Appoints Four Secretaries

President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has approved the appointment of four new Permanent Secretaries in the Federal Civil Service, filling key vacancies across ministries and departments.

The appointments were announced on Thursday in Abuja by Eno Olotu, Director of Information and Public Relations in the Office of the Head of the Civil Service of the Federation (HCSF).

The newly appointed Permanent Secretaries are:

·       Mrs. Warrens Augusta (Bayelsa State)

·       Mrs. Jones-Nebo Bella (Enugu State)

·       Mr. Aminu Yargaya (Kano State)

·       Mr. Shoretire Kamil (Ogun State)

Olotu stated that the appointments followed a rigorous and transparent selection process, reflecting the administration’s commitment to meritocracy and excellence within the civil service.
“The new permanent secretaries will bring their wealth of experience and expertise to their roles, which will further strengthen public service delivery and support the government’s development agenda,” she said.

Meanwhile, Didi Walson-Jack congratulated the appointees and commended President Tinubu for promoting transparency, meritocracy, and professionalism. She noted that the appointments demonstrate the administration’s commitment to building a competent, results-oriented public service capable of meeting the needs of Nigerians.

These appointments mark a strategic effort by the Tinubu administration to ensure that leadership in the civil service is skilled, accountable, and aligned with national development priorities.
